Nevada had positive net migration with 23 states in 2024.

In 2024, people leaving Nevada most often moved to California, Florida, and Texas.

In 2024, newcomers arrived in Nevada most often from California, Texas, and Florida.

Migration routes between Nevada and other states (2024)
| Residence 1 year ago | Estimate | |
|---|---|---|
| 1. | California | 53,300 |
| 2. | Texas | 8,300 |
| 3. | Florida | 6,300 |
| 4. | Arizona | 5,500 |
| 5. | Washington state | 4,900 |
| 6. | Virginia | 4,600 |
| 7. | Colorado | 3,900 |
| 8. | Utah | 3,400 |
| 9. | Illinois | 3,100 |
| 10. | Georgia | 2,600 |
